Which food should be introduced first to a 6-month-old infant?

  • A. Fruits
  • B. Eggs
  • C. Vegetables
  • D. Meat
Correct Answer: C

Rationale: Vegetables, particularly pureed ones, are often recommended as a first solid food for infants because they are easy to digest and less likely to cause allergies. Fruits can be introduced later due to their natural sweetness, while eggs and meat are typically introduced after fruits and vegetables as they may pose a higher risk of allergies.
